What is the MACSL Technique™?

The MACSL Technique™ is a proprietary system of manual therapy designed to support lymphatic movement, circulation, and recovery through precise, structured application.

Developed through clinical experience and practical application, MACSL integrates:

  • Lymphatic-focused techniques

  • Circulatory support methods

  • Sports recovery applications

  • Pre- and post-procedural considerations

This method is designed for integration into professional practice settings including massage therapy and physical therapy environments.

Program Structure

Total Certification Requirement: 32 Hours
Delivered across 4 workshops (8 hours each)

Level 1 – Foundations of MACSL (8 Hours)

  • Introduction to MACSL methodology

  • Lymphatic system principles (practical application focus)

  • Foundational hands-on techniques

  • Safety, contraindications, and scope awareness

Level 2 – Functional Application (8 Hours)

  • Targeted lymphatic techniques

  • Circulation-focused treatment strategies

  • Sports recovery applications

  • Structuring effective treatment flow

Level 3 – Advanced Integration (8 Hours)

  • Pre- and post-procedural protocols

  • Application for inflammation and recovery support

  • Integrating MACSL with existing modalities

  • Client-specific customization

Level 4 – Clinical Mastery & Certification (8 Hours)

  • Full-session execution and refinement

  • Case-based treatment design

  • Practical evaluation

  • Final certification assessment

Certification Requirements

To be awarded MACSL Certification™, participants must:

  • Complete all 4 levels (32 total hours)

  • Successfully pass the final practical assessment

  • Provide proof of professional credentials (license or active education status)

  • Be employed by, or own, a legally operating massage therapy or physical therapy practice at the time of certification
